§ 5191. Property subject to distraint

At the expiration of the time for payment of tax as given in the notice required by section 4772(a) of this title or sooner in the case of a person whom he has just reason to believe is about to remove from town, the collector may distrain the goods, chattels and capital stock in a corporation of a person whose tax is not paid. In the case of taxes assessed on real estate, he shall not distrain upon apparel, bedding, household furniture necessary for supporting life, one sewing machine kept for use or provisions not exceeding $25.00 in value.
